Question 378141: solve(3x)^2-12√(3x)+27=0 using the quadratic equation.
explain the steps please?

Answer by stanbon(75887)   (Show Source): You can put this solution on YOUR website!
solve(3x)^2-12√(3x)+27=0 using the quadratic equation.
-----
It is not a quadratic the way you have posted it.
----
The following would be the quadratic form:
(3x)^2 - 12(3x) + 27 = 0
----
Letting w = 3x you get:
w^2 - 12w + 27 = 0
(w-9)(w-3) = 0
w = 9 or w = 3
-----
Solving for "x":
3x=9 or 3x=3
x = 3 or x = 1
